Elk Grove, CA
Sacramento County
Elk Grove requires clear sight distance triangles at intersections and driveways. Fences, walls, and landscaping within the sight triangle are typically limited to 3 feet in height to protect traffic safety.

Sacramento County
Sacramento County requires a clear sight triangle of 25 feet at corner lots. Fences, walls, and landscaping over 3 feet tall are prohibited in this triangle.

Elk Grove FAQ
Can I have a 6 foot fence on a corner lot?
Not within the sight distance triangle. Fences and hedges within the triangle are capped at 3 feet.
What if my neighbor landscaping blocks my driveway view?
Report to Elk Grove Code Enforcement. Driveway sight triangles require reduced vegetation height at typically 10 to 15 feet from the drive.
Vineyard FAQ
Does a 3-foot picket fence count?
Yes. Anything solid or semi-solid over 3 feet violates the rule, but a 3-foot picket at that height is permitted.
What if my existing hedge is taller?
You will receive a notice to trim. Failure to trim may result in County abatement with costs billed to you.
